Strs Ohio Invests $752,000 in Gorman-Rupp Company (The) $GRC

Strs Ohio bought a new position in shares of Gorman-Rupp Company (The) (NYSE:GRCFree Report) during the first qu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und bought 12,100 shares of the industrial products company’s stock, valued at approximately $752,000.

About Gorman-Rupp

(Free Report)

Gorman-Rupp Company is a U.S.-based manufacturer specializing in the design, production and distribution of pumps and pumping systems. Its product lineup includes centrifugal self-priming pumps, submersible pumps, vacuum priming pumps and engineered pumps for applications such as water and wastewater management, sewage handling, dewatering, industrial processing and agricultural irrigation. The company supports both standard pump requirements and custom engineered solutions for original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) and municipal clients.

Headquartered in Mansfield, Ohio, Gorman-Rupp has built a reputation for rugged, reliable equipment and aftermarket support services.
